Thane: Tree falls during thundershowers, killing two

They were seeking shelter from the sudden rains when the tree fell on them

Thane: Two men were killed after a palm tree fell on them during the thundershowers with strong winds earlier this week in Thane. According to a report in The Times of India, the police said that the  deceased Aman Liaqat Shaikh (19) and RD Jaiswal (30) were taking shelter under the 50-feet palm tree that snapped into two during the gusty winds and the thundershower Tuesday night.

Shaikh, a Mumbra resident, was on his way home when he stood that the spot with Jaiswal, a mobile accessories vendor near an MSRTC bus stop in Thane (West) seeking shelter from the sudden rains when they got crushed under the tree, the hawkers at the spot were quoting saying.
